Abstract

The methodology developed to assess the state of forest ecosystems in the zone of influence of atmospheric emissions from metallurgical enterprises is applied to assess the impact of the Kursk nuclear power plant. It is shown that this NPP is a relatively clean facility, the impact of which on the environment is minimal.
